Medicine overview

Indications of Livita

Livita is a combination nutritional/hematinic preparation used for the treatment and prevention of combined iron, vitamin B-complex, and zinc deficiency. Its main uses, classified by strength of evidence, are:

Established / guideline-supported uses

  • Treatment of mild-to-moderate iron-deficiency anemia when accompanied by vitamin B-complex and/or zinc insufficiency, where a combined preparation is clinically appropriate.
  • Prevention and treatment of nutritional deficiency of iron, B-complex vitamins, and zinc during pregnancy and lactation, when increased requirements are not met by diet alone.
  • Nutritional supplementation in children and adults with dietary insufficiency, poor intake, or increased physiological demand (growth, convalescence after illness).

Adjunct / supportive use

  • As an adjunct to dietary correction and treatment of the underlying cause of deficiency (e.g., blood loss, malabsorption), not as a substitute for identifying and managing that cause.

Note: Livita is a fixed combination and is not the preferred choice when an isolated, severe single-nutrient deficiency (for example severe iron-deficiency anemia alone) requires higher-dose single-agent therapy; in such cases a physician may prefer a single-ingredient iron product instead.

Composition

Formulations of Livita marketed in Bangladesh typically contain, per dose unit (strength varies by brand and dosage form - syrup, capsule, or drops):

  • Elemental iron 50 mg (as Iron (III)-hydroxide polymaltose complex) per 5 mL, or equivalent per capsule
  • Thiamine hydrochloride (Vitamin B1) - approx. 5 mg
  • Riboflavin sodium phosphate (Vitamin B2) - approx. 2 mg
  • Pyridoxine hydrochloride (Vitamin B6) - approx. 2 mg
  • Nicotinamide (Vitamin B3) - approx. 20 mg
  • Elemental zinc (as zinc sulphate monohydrate) - approx. 10 mg

Exact strengths differ between brands; always check the product label/pack insert for the specific formulation dispensed.

Description

Livita is a multi-ingredient oral supplement combining a non-ionic, polymaltose-bound form of trivalent (ferric) iron with B-complex vitamins (thiamine, riboflavin, pyridoxine, nicotinamide) and elemental zinc. The iron in this product is bound in a stable macromolecular complex rather than existing as a simple ionic (ferrous) salt, which is associated with more controlled intestinal absorption and generally better gastrointestinal tolerability than conventional ferrous iron salts (e.g., ferrous sulfate).

Livita is used to correct or prevent combined deficiency of iron, B-complex vitamins, and zinc, which commonly occurs together in pregnancy, lactation, childhood growth, and states of poor dietary intake or increased nutritional demand.

Theropeutic Class

Livita belongs to the therapeutic class of Iron and Vitamin Combined Preparations (hematinics with multivitamin/mineral supplementation), used as a nutritional supplement and antianemic agent.

Pharmacology

Livita combines three pharmacologically distinct components:

  • Iron (III)-hydroxide polymaltose complex: Unlike ionic ferrous salts, this non-ionic complex is absorbed through a controlled, active (carrier-mediated) mechanism at the mucosal surface of the duodenum and proximal jejunum, rather than by passive diffusion. This limits the amount of unbound free iron reaching the bloodstream, which is thought to reduce the pro-oxidant gastrointestinal irritation seen with ferrous salts. Absorbed iron is transported bound to transferrin, stored as ferritin in the liver, spleen and bone marrow, and incorporated into hemoglobin, myoglobin, and iron-containing enzymes.
  • B-complex vitamins (thiamine, riboflavin, pyridoxine, nicotinamide): Function as coenzymes/coenzyme precursors in carbohydrate, fat, and protein metabolism, and support normal red blood cell formation and nervous system function.
  • Zinc: An essential trace element that is a cofactor for numerous enzymes and is required for normal growth, immune function, wound healing, and taste/appetite regulation.

Dosage & Administration of Livita

Dosage of Livita should be individualized by a physician based on the degree of deficiency, age, and formulation (syrup, drops, or capsule/tablet). Typical dosing ranges reported for iron-polymaltose-based combination products are summarized below; the specific product label should always be checked for the exact strength dispensed.

PopulationTypical DoseFrequency
Adults (including pregnant/lactating women)5-10 mL syrup (or 1 capsule, depending on formulation)1-3 times daily, or as advised by physician
Children (older children)5 mL syrup1-3 times daily, adjusted to age and degree of deficiency
InfantsApprox. 0.3 mL/kg body weight/day, weight-based dosingDivided doses as advised by physician

Duration of treatment for correction of iron-deficiency anemia is typically continued for several weeks to a few months, including a period after hemoglobin normalizes, to replenish body iron stores (see Duration of Treatment).

Dosage of Livita

Usual adult dose of Livita is 5-10 mL of syrup (or the equivalent capsule/tablet strength) once to three times daily. Pediatric and infant doses are lower and generally weight- or age-based. The exact dose depends on the severity of deficiency and the specific brand/strength prescribed - always follow the physician's prescription or the product label.

Administration of Livita

Livita is taken orally. It may be taken with or after meals to improve gastrointestinal tolerability; unlike conventional ferrous iron salts, iron polymaltose complex absorption is less significantly reduced by food, so it can be given with meals if GI upset occurs on an empty stomach. Shake liquid formulations well before use and measure the dose with the measuring cup/spoon provided. Do not mix directly with tea, coffee, milk, or calcium-rich foods/supplements at the same time, as these may still reduce absorption; separate intake from these by at least 1-2 hours where possible.

Interaction of Livita

Because iron in Livita is bound in a stable polymaltose complex rather than existing as a free ionic salt, it is less prone to the classic chelation-type interactions seen with ferrous iron salts, but some clinically relevant interactions still apply:

  • Tetracycline and fluoroquinolone antibiotics: Concurrent iron and zinc intake can reduce absorption of these antibiotics (and vice versa) through chelate formation; separate dosing by at least 2-3 hours.
  • Other oral iron or mineral supplements: Concomitant use with other iron-containing products should be avoided to prevent cumulative iron overload.
  • Penicillamine and levodopa: Zinc and iron may reduce absorption/efficacy of these drugs; separate administration times if co-prescribed.
  • Antacids and calcium/phytate/tannin-rich foods (tea, coffee): May modestly reduce absorption of the iron and zinc components; the polymaltose-bound iron is less affected than ferrous salts, but spacing intake from these substances is still advisable.

Contraindications

Livita is contraindicated in:

  • Known hypersensitivity to iron polymaltose complex, any B-vitamin component, zinc, or any excipient of the formulation.
  • Conditions of iron overload or impaired iron utilization, including hemochromatosis, hemosiderosis, and hemolytic anemias not associated with iron deficiency, where additional iron intake can be harmful.

Side Effects of Livita

Livita is generally well tolerated, with gastrointestinal side effects that are typically milder than those seen with conventional ferrous iron salts. Reported side effects include:

  • Nausea, epigastric discomfort or fullness
  • Constipation or, less commonly, diarrhea
  • Dark or discolored stools - this is an expected, harmless effect of the iron component and does not indicate gastrointestinal bleeding
  • Mild vomiting or dyspepsia in some patients
  • Uncommonly, metallic taste or mild headache

Most gastrointestinal effects are dose-related and can often be reduced by taking the dose with food.

Pregnancy & Lactation

Livita is commonly used to meet the increased nutritional demand for iron, B-vitamins, and zinc during pregnancy and lactation, and combination iron/multivitamin/mineral supplements of this type are frequently recommended in this setting. However, as with any supplement taken during pregnancy or breastfeeding, it should be used only under medical supervision, at the dose advised by the physician, with the potential benefit weighed against any individual risk factors. Excessive supplementation beyond the prescribed dose should be avoided. Consult a physician before use if pregnant, planning pregnancy, or breastfeeding.

Precautions & Warnings

The following precautions apply to the use of Livita :

  • Iron overload risk: Use with caution in patients with a history of, or risk factors for, iron overload; monitor iron status during prolonged use (see Contraindications for absolute iron-overload contraindications).
  • Accidental ingestion by children: Although iron polymaltose complex has a different, generally less acutely toxic profile than ferrous iron salts in accidental overdose, all iron-containing products should still be kept out of reach of children, as unsupervised ingestion of a large quantity can still be harmful.
  • Zinc component - chronic excess intake: Prolonged use of doses higher than recommended can lead to zinc-induced copper deficiency, which may cause anemia and neurological effects; do not exceed the prescribed dose or duration without medical advice.
  • Absorption-reducing substances: Tea, coffee, and calcium-rich foods or supplements may reduce absorption of the iron and zinc components if taken at the same time; space intake apart where practical.
  • Gastrointestinal disease: Use with caution in patients with active peptic ulcer disease, ulcerative colitis, or other significant GI disorders, as gastrointestinal symptoms may be aggravated.

Overdose Effects of Livita

Deliberate or accidental overdose of Livita should be treated as a medical emergency. While the iron polymaltose complex in this product has a different and generally less acutely dangerous overdose profile than conventional ferrous iron salts (due to its controlled, non-passive absorption), taking a much larger than recommended amount can still cause epigastric pain, nausea, vomiting, diarrhea, and, in significant overdose, metabolic acidosis or other systemic effects.

If overdose is suspected, seek immediate medical attention or contact a poison control center/emergency services right away. Do not attempt to treat an overdose at home; take the product container with you to the hospital. Do not induce vomiting unless specifically instructed by a medical professional or poison control.

Storage Conditions

Store at room temperature (below 30°C), away from light and moisture. Keep out of reach of children.

Use In Special Populations

Pediatric use: Livita is used in children, including infants, for treatment/prevention of combined iron, B-complex, and zinc deficiency, using age- and weight-based dosing under medical supervision (see Pediatric Uses).

Elderly: No specific dose reduction is typically required in the elderly, but iron status and renal/GI function should be considered; use the lowest effective dose.

Renal impairment: Specific dose-adjustment data for this fixed combination in renal impairment are limited; use with caution and physician supervision.

Hepatic impairment: Use with caution, as iron metabolism/storage can be affected in significant liver disease; specific dose-adjustment data are limited for this combination.

Pregnancy and lactation: See Pregnancy and Lactation section above.

Duration Of Treatment

Duration of treatment with Livita depends on the indication and the degree of deficiency, and should be determined by the prescribing physician. For correction of iron-deficiency anemia, treatment is typically continued for several weeks after hemoglobin returns to normal (commonly an additional 4-12 weeks) in order to replenish body iron stores. For general nutritional supplementation (e.g., during pregnancy/lactation), it may be continued for the relevant period as advised by the physician. Response should be monitored periodically (e.g., hemoglobin/iron studies) and treatment duration adjusted accordingly.

Mode Of Action

The iron component of Livita - iron (III)-hydroxide polymaltose complex - is absorbed via a controlled, receptor/carrier-mediated active transport mechanism at the intestinal mucosa (mainly duodenum and proximal jejunum), in contrast to the passive diffusion of ionic iron from ferrous salts. This limits free unbound iron in the circulation and is associated with better gastrointestinal tolerability. Absorbed iron binds to transferrin for transport, is stored as ferritin, and is incorporated into hemoglobin and iron-dependent enzymes. The accompanying B-complex vitamins act as essential coenzymes in energy and hematopoietic metabolism, while zinc serves as a cofactor for enzymes involved in growth, immune function, and cellular metabolism.

Pediatric Uses

Livita is used in pediatric patients, including infants and older children, for the prevention and treatment of combined iron, vitamin B-complex, and zinc deficiency, using age- and weight-appropriate liquid (syrup/drops) formulations. Typical guidance:

  • Infants: weight-based dosing (approximately 0.3 mL/kg/day of syrup, divided), only under physician guidance.
  • Older children: approximately 5 mL syrup, one to three times daily, adjusted to age and severity of deficiency.

As with all iron-containing products, caution parents/caregivers about safe storage out of reach of children, since accidental ingestion of a large quantity can be harmful even though this iron form is generally less acutely toxic than ferrous iron salts. Safety and efficacy in neonates and very young infants should be established by a pediatrician on a case-by-case basis.

Frequently Asked Questions

Q: What is Livita used for?

A: Livita is used to treat and prevent combined deficiency of iron, B-complex vitamins, and zinc - most commonly during pregnancy, lactation, childhood growth, or when dietary intake is insufficient to meet the body's needs.

Q: Is Livita easier on the stomach than regular iron tablets?

A: Yes. Livita contains iron in a non-ionic polymaltose-bound form, which is absorbed through a controlled mechanism and is generally associated with milder gastrointestinal side effects (nausea, constipation) compared with conventional ferrous iron salts like ferrous sulfate.

Q: Can I take Livita with tea or coffee?

A: It is best to avoid taking Livita at the same time as tea, coffee, or calcium-rich foods/supplements, as these may reduce absorption of the iron and zinc components. While the polymaltose-bound iron in Livita is less affected by food than ferrous salts, spacing intake by 1-2 hours from these substances is still recommended.

Q: Is it dangerous if a child accidentally swallows Livita ?

A: Accidental ingestion of iron-containing products by children is always a safety concern, and while the iron in Livita has a different, generally less acutely toxic profile than conventional ferrous iron salts in overdose, it should still be treated seriously. Keep Livita out of reach of children at all times, and seek immediate medical attention or contact a poison control center if accidental ingestion of a large amount is suspected.

Q: Can Livita be taken long-term?

A: Livita can be used for the duration advised by a physician, but chronic use of zinc-containing supplements above the recommended dose can cause zinc-induced copper deficiency over time. Long-term use should be under medical supervision, with periodic review of the need for continued supplementation.

Q: Is Livita safe during pregnancy?

A: Livita is commonly used during pregnancy and lactation to meet increased nutritional needs, but it should only be taken under medical supervision, at the dose prescribed by your physician, since your doctor will weigh the benefits against any individual risk factors before recommending it.
